Department of Obstetrics and Gynecology
The Department of Obstetrics and Gynecology (Ob/Gyn) provides comprehensive obstetrical and gynecological care for women of all ages. Our newly renovated maternity service offers single-bedded, private, family-friendly labor and delivery rooms; private postpartum rooms with rooming-in services; state-of-the-art equipment; and an advanced security system.

The spacious newborn nursery has fully-equipped Neonatal Intensive Care, Intermediate Care, and Continuing Care Units; a well-baby nursery; and a dedicated breastfeeding education room. As a Level 3 nursery and member of the Regional Perinatal Center at Bellevue Hospital, we are capable of caring for the most acutely sick or at-risk pregnant women and newborns. 

Your primary Ob/Gyn provider will work with you to manage your care and coordinate referrals to other services. The caregivers are board certified/eligible physicians, physician assistants, nurse practitioners, and certified midwives. We offer free language assistance services to patients who do not speak English well.

  • Woman, Infants and Children (WIC) - a supplemental nutrition program that provides free, healthy foods for pregnant or breast-feeding women and children under the age of 5. You receive checks every month to buy the food you and your children need, ideas on how to prepare healthy and tasty meals for your family, and help in getting other healthcare services you need.
